Features of the Polaroid Hi-Print in 2026
- Wireless Connectivity: Seamlessly connect with smartphones via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i.
- High-Quality Prints: Produces vibrant, durable photos in seconds.
- Compact Design: Fits easily into bags and pockets, ideal for on-the-go printing.
- Customizable Prints: Offers filters, borders, and editing options for personalized photos.
